About this home

Tropical Paradise Meets Coastal Luxury in Seabury, Huntington Beach Welcome to this stunning Tommy Bahama-inspired Hawaiian estate, offering nearly 3,900 sq. ft. of luxurious living just under a mile from the beach in the prestigious Seabury neighborhood of Huntington Beach. Completely rebuilt in 2012, this 5-bedroom, 3.5-bath masterpiece blends timeless island elegance with modern sophistication. Designed with comfort and convenience, the home features **dual master suites**—one on each level—an **elevator**, and a spacious indoor laundry room. Soaring **9-foot ceilings**, **crown molding**, **porcelain tile**, and **walnut laminate floors** create a rich yet relaxed ambiance throughout. The chef’s kitchen is a culinary dream with high-end appliances, a wrap-around island, granite countertops, and under-cabinet lighting—ideally situated for entertaining. The open-concept layout includes a grand family room with a granite fireplace, a sophisticated living room with custom stonework, and two banquet-sized dining areas ideal for gatherings. Upstairs, a large bonus room with a wet bar and access to a covered balcony extends your living space even further. The upstairs primary suite is a private retreat, complete with a separate sitting area, custom walk-in closet, balcony, and spa-inspired bathroom boasting a jetted tub and marble shower. Step outside to your backyard oasis—an entertainer’s dream—with lush **tropical landscaping**, multiple **palapa-covered patios**, and a **slate outdoor kitchen/BBQ center** under a thatched roof with skylights. This one-of-a-kind coastal haven captures the essence of **California indoor-outdoor living**.

Condition Rating
Excellent

Despite the original build year of 1969, this property was 'completely rebuilt in 2012,' making it effectively a 12-year-old home in terms of its major systems and finishes. The description and images showcase a high-end, luxurious property with a chef's kitchen featuring granite countertops, high-end stainless steel appliances, and custom cabinetry. Bathrooms are spa-inspired with jetted tubs, marble showers, and modern fixtures. The overall condition is pristine, with quality materials like porcelain tile, walnut laminate floors, and crown molding throughout. Additional luxury features like an elevator and a sophisticated outdoor kitchen further support an 'excellent' rating, indicating virtually new components meeting current quality standards with no visible deferred maintenance.
Pros & Cons

Pros

Extensive Renovation & Modernization: Completely rebuilt in 2012, this property offers modern amenities and finishes, effectively functioning as a much newer home despite its original 1969 build year.
Exceptional Outdoor Living & Entertainment: The backyard oasis features lush tropical landscaping, multiple palapa-covered patios, and a slate outdoor kitchen/BBQ center, perfectly embodying California indoor-outdoor living.
Luxury Amenities & High-End Finishes: The home boasts premium features such as dual master suites, an elevator, 9-foot ceilings, crown molding, porcelain tile, walnut laminate floors, a chef’s kitchen with high-end appliances, and a spa-inspired primary bathroom.
Prime Coastal Location: Situated just under a mile from the beach in the prestigious Seabury neighborhood of Huntington Beach, offering desirable proximity to the coast and a sought-after community.
Versatile & Spacious Layout: The open-concept design includes a grand family room, sophisticated living room, two banquet-sized dining areas, and a large bonus room with a wet bar, providing ample and flexible spaces for living and entertaining.

Cons

Original Build Year: While extensively rebuilt in 2012, the original construction year of 1969 might raise questions for some buyers regarding the age of underlying infrastructure not explicitly mentioned as replaced.
Niche Design Aesthetic: The 'Tommy Bahama-inspired Hawaiian estate' theme, while luxurious and unique, may appeal to a specific taste and potentially limit the buyer pool compared to a more universally neutral design.
Lot Size vs. Home Footprint: With nearly 3,900 sq. ft. of living space on a 6,000 sq. ft. lot, the house occupies a significant portion of the land, potentially leaving a smaller usable yard space than some buyers might desire, despite the well-appointed outdoor oasis.
